فایل BPS چیست؟
A “.bps” file extension typically refers to a Binary Patch File. These files are used to apply patches or updates to existing files or software. Here is some more information about BPS files:
Patch Files: BPS files contain binary data that represents the changes needed to update or modify an existing file or program. Instead of replacing the entire file, patch files only include the differences between the original file and the updated version.
هک ROM: فایل های BPS معمولا در زمینه هک رام استفاده می شوند. هکرهای ROM از فایلهای BPS برای توزیع وصلههایی استفاده میکنند که کد یا محتوای بازی را در رامهای کلاسیک بازی ویدیویی تغییر میدهند. بازیکنان می توانند این پچ ها را در رام های بازی خود اعمال کنند تا تغییرات و ترجمه های ساخته شده توسط طرفداران را تجربه کنند.
برنامه وصله: برای اعمال یک پچ BPS، به یک ابزار وصله نیاز دارید. ابزارهای پچینگ محبوب مانند Floating IPS یا Beat به شما امکان می دهند وصله های BPS را در فایل ROM مربوطه اعمال کنید و یک نسخه اصلاح شده از بازی یا نرم افزار ایجاد کنید.
در بخش های بعدی، برنامه های نرم افزاری مرتبط با فایل های BPS را بررسی خواهیم کرد.
IPS شناور
Floating IPS (Flips) یک ابزار محبوب و کاربرپسند برای اعمال وصله ها به فایل های رام در زمینه هک رام است. معمولاً در جوامع شبیه سازی و ترجمه طرفداران استفاده می شود. برخی از اطلاعات بیشتر مرتبط با آن در زیر آورده شده است.
برنامه وصله: IPS شناور برای اعمال فایل های پچ، معمولاً با فرمت BPS، بر روی فایل های ROM طراحی شده است. این وصلهها حاوی دادههای باینری هستند که نشاندهنده تغییرات رام اصلی، مانند ترجمهها، رفع باگها، یا تغییرات گیمپلی هستند.
وصله خودکار: IPS شناور به طور خودکار هدر ROM مورد نظر را شناسایی می کند و بر اساس آن پچ را اعمال می کند و فرآیند وصله را ساده می کند.
تأیید جمعبندی چک: این ابزار اغلب شامل یک ویژگی تأیید چکسوم برای اطمینان از یکپارچگی رام وصلهشده، کاهش خطر خطا یا فساد میشود.
ایجاد وصله: در حالی که IPS شناور در درجه اول برای اعمال وصله ها استفاده می شود، همچنین می توان از آن برای ایجاد فایل های پچ (فرمت BPS) از تفاوت بین دو رام استفاده کرد که آن را برای هک کردن رام و پروژه های ترجمه مفید می کند.
MultiPatch
MultiPatch ابزار دیگری است که معمولاً در جامعه هک رام استفاده می شود، مخصوصاً برای اعمال وصله روی فایل های ROM. از نظر عملکرد شبیه به IPS شناور است اما دارای ویژگی ها و رابط خاص خود است. برخی از اطلاعات بیشتر مرتبط با آن در زیر آورده شده است.
برنامه وصله: MultiPatch برای اعمال وصله ها به فایل های ROM، معمولاً در فرمت هایی مانند IPS، UPS، یا BPS طراحی شده است. این وصله ها حاوی داده های باینری هستند که رام اصلی را تغییر می دهند، اغلب برای مقاصدی مانند ترجمه، رفع اشکال یا سفارشی سازی.
پشتیبانی از فرمت های مختلف پچ: از طیف وسیعی از فرمت های فایل پچ، از جمله IPS (سیستم وصله بین المللی)، UPS (فرمت وصله جهانی) و BPS (سیستم وصله باینری) پشتیبانی می کند که آن را برای انواع مختلف همه کاره می کند. تکه ها
** Patch Batch: ** MultiPatch را می توان برای اعمال چندین وصله روی یک فایل ROM یا چندین فایل ROM به طور همزمان استفاده کرد که برای هک های ROM پیچیده یا پروژه هایی که شامل چندین وصله هستند مفید است.
ایجاد پچ: مانند Floating IPS، MultiPatch همچنین می تواند برای ایجاد فایل های پچ از تفاوت بین دو رام استفاده شود که برای پروژه های هک رام و ترجمه مفید است.
چگونه فایل BPS را باز کنیم؟
برنامه هایی که فایل های BPS را باز می کنند شامل
- IPS شناور (رایگان) برای (MAC، ویندوز و لینوکس)
- MultiPatch (رایگان) برای (MAC)
سایر فایل های BPS
در اینجا انواع فایل دیگری وجود دارد که از پسوند فایل .bps استفاده می کنند.
منابع
See Also
- فرمت فایل BPS - فایل بدافزار BPS از SpywareCops
- فرمت فایل BPS - پشتیبانگیری از سند Microsoft Works
- SMC File - Super Nintendo Game ROM - فایل .smc چیست و چگونه آن را باز کنیم؟
- فایل BIB - BibTeX Bibliography - فایل .bib چیست و چگونه آن را باز کنیم؟
- فایل FS - Visual F# Source File - فایل .fs چیست و چگونه آن را باز کنیم؟